Mets Formally Introduce Van Wagenen, Who Is Committed To Winning

On Tuesday at Citi Field, Mets’ Chief Operating Officer, Jeff Wilpon, introduced new general manager Brodie Van Wagenen to the media. Wilpon said that the team had targeted around 40 names who could potentially be the Mets’ next GM. That field was then narrowed down to a dozen, who were called in for interviews. Six Mets Became Free Agents on Monday

Now that the 2018 baseball season is officially over, the offseason has begun. With that, six Mets became free agents on Monday. Left-handed reliever Jerry Blevins, right-handed reliever AJ Ramos, catchers Devin Mesoraco and Jose Lobaton, infielder Jose Reyes and outfielder Austin Jackson are now free to sign with any team.
